Shoreline Change Modeling, APTIM Work Order No. 2018008-04 <br />September 13, 2022 BCC Meeting <br />In response to the County's request for additional modeling support associated with the Sebastian <br />Inlet TAC, APTIM has prepared Work Order No. 2018008-4 to provide a modeling analysis of the <br />shoreline performance over specified timeframes. Work Order No. 2018008-4 includes APTIM's <br />modeling effort and associated meeting and coordination efforts.
